No, it will not. We have had same experience. I investigated the boards
myself (years ago)and found no detrimental impact. We asked both Roger and
Taconic why that tarnish, but they had no answers. We changed to Arlon, and
had no further issues. It seems to be a batch dependent phenomenon, because
some batches were not affected at all. We did not dig in that any further.

Hi Technetters,
I am facing a problem with boards that are of Roger material and was
tin/lead plated.
We subject the boards to reflow, and those area where no solder joint
turned tarnished.
I wander will the signal or frequency be affected by the oxide formed
on the surface.
